Guwahati: Assam, which was yet to start Aadhaar card enrollment, has decided to start data collection from December this year. Assam is the only state besides Jammu and Kashmir where Aadhaar cards were not issued.

Assam chief minister Sarbananda Sonowal on Friday directed the General Administration Department (GAD) that data collection for Aadhaar card should begin from December 1 and the whole process must be completed within a year time.

The chief minister has also advised that local vendors must be engaged in the process that entails about expenditure of Rs 160 crore for providing Aadhaar card to 3.18 crore people of the state.

Mr Sonowal also asked the GAD to undertake awareness campaigns through street plays and short films for making people aware about the importance of Aadhaar card. Meanwhile, Mr Sonowal has asked officials to start process of setting up a mini-secretariat of the state government in the Barak Valley.
